Output 62ec93810ac44b54de9fdfe4121bfb7140fa75e60d73eb9067ad02362ebcac31:10

value
137865
script pubkey
OP_0 OP_PUSHBYTES_32 de196f5f7437bd9dbba600d01b56e917e50d93bfc07f0d567411653439b7a1b2
address
bc1qmcvk7hm5x77emwaxqrgpk4hfzljsmyalcpls64n5z9jngwdh5xeq4mxwdw
transaction
62ec93810ac44b54de9fdfe4121bfb7140fa75e60d73eb9067ad02362ebcac31
confirmations
193484
spent
true